Try switching to dry food.

Do you generally feed your pup wet food? If yes, then maybe you should try feeding him dry pet food as it contains less moisture.

Water content in the dog food can sometimes give your dog watery and bulky stool. So, when he starts eating dry food, it will reduce the amount of stool and help to make it hard.

Remember, while switching your dog food, make sure the pace is slow. Do not suddenly add wet food to his diet. You have to add kibbles to his old food and then gradually increase the portion.

Add fibers

With the help of fiber, you can cure watery stool problems in dogs. It soaks the water and aids in making the stool firm. Moreover, it can keep your dog fueled for long and keep the calorie intake low.

Make sure to always be extra careful while feeding your pup fibers because a lot of fiber can lead to stomach aches. Always choose dog food that has 10% crude fiber. 

You can also add fiber to their diet by feeding them oats, wheat bran, and pumpkin. Try feeding fruits that are full of fibers like apples, bananas, and mango.

FACT: One tbsp for a 20 pounds weight dog is an ideal fiber amount for a dog.

Try feeding your dog less to get firm poop.

Feeding less food can also reduce the chance of watery stool. It helps the digestive system relax. In case your dog is worried and has anxiety issues, it can impact its digestive system and lead to loose stool.

For 12 to 24 hours, don’t give your dog food. Give him water frequently in small amounts. It will clean all gastric problems and give the intestine relief.

If you are going to make your dog go fast, make sure that it is healthy enough to handle it. I won’t recommend this for small dogs.

Then the next day, give him half a meal. On the third day, you should see results.

Overfeeding your dog can increase defecation frequently and prompts soft poop. 

You can detect if your eating is overeating. 

Just run your hands from shoulders to hips. If you feel the ribs, that means he is not obese. But, in case you cannot feel his ribs, that is a sign your dog is overeating. And it is a call for action to reduce his meal portion.

Feed bland foods to harden dog stool

Give your dog a break from kibbles. Instead, try making bland food for your dog at home. It aids your dog’s intestine.

You can make boiled rice using either short grain or medium grain rice. White or brown doesn’t matter; whichever is available, you can feed. 

Make sure the rice is soft and tender. To add protein portion to his diet, you can make chicken stew. You can use canned chicken or boneless stew.

Add half portion of chicken stew and half a portion of rice. It will give him a balance of protein, and carbs and promote brown and firm poop.

Deworm your dog

The presence of flatworms, roundworms, protozoa, or any parasite can ruin the mucosa (the innermost layer of the gastrointestinal tract).

If your canine is affected by hookworms, you can see blood in his stool; it is a prevalent symptom because it damages the lining of the dog’s intestine. 

In general, almost every parasite that gives diarrhea attacks the dog’s small intestine.

However, parasites like Trichuris vulpis attack the large intestine, which leads to colitis (inflammation of the lining of the colon)

As a result, parasites can also be one of the reasons why your dog is facing diarrhea issues, so to make his stool hard, you can take deworm treatment. 

You have to speak to your vet and get the deworming treatment. Start a deworming regimen, so they don’t experience this problem again.

FAQs

Does banana firm up dog stool?

Banana contains a good portion of fiber, which can help dogs have firm stool because fiber helps to push and transport food into the dog’s intestine. It relieves diarrhea and constipation.

But, feed a small piece of banana.

Does pumpkin firm up dog stool?

Pumpkin has a fair amount of fiber content that helps dogs have firm stool as it soaks excess water in their stomach. As a result, it promotes bulkier and softer stool.

Why is my dog’s poop always soft?

If you find that your dog’s stool is slippery, watery, and hard to pick in the bag, then it is a sign of diarrhea. Your dog’s colon is not correctly working because it helps to soak excess water from your dog’s intestine.
